I’ve been having success on the East side, South of the boat ramp in 40ish FOW. I have only fished in the afternoon. The bite can be very light and you have to have you gear/presentation on point. All my rods have spring bobbers on them and I use line with very little memory. Any curled slack in your line will absorb those light bites and you’ll never know you were getting hit. I use wax worms until I get a fish up, then eyes after that. My two cents. Good luck.
